Hi. I am a Malaysian planning to visit Macau & China this coming 3 December 2009. When should I apply my visa? I plan to stay in Macau with my relatives but shops in Zhuhai & Punyu in China throughout the one week period. What kind of visa is recommended? Thanks in advance for your advise.

For malaysian passport holders, no visa is required if they stay in Macau for less than 3o days. But you have to apply a L tourist visa to Zhuhai & Panyu of mainland China for your one week shopping.
